GUIDELINES FOR SHEETMETAL FABRICATOR/MECHANIC

Function: The Fabricators are responsible for accomplishing work in accordance with work specifications safely, with the highest quality, in a professional manner

 

Functions May Include:

  • Plan, lay out, assemble, and repair sheet metal parts, equipment, and products, utilizing knowledge of working characteristics of metallic and nonmetallic materials, machining, and layout techniques
  • Use hand tools, power tools, machines, and equipment
  • Read, and interpret blueprints, sketches, or product specifications to determine sequence and methods of fabricating, assembling, and installing sheet metal products
  • Select gauges, types, and quantities of materials according to product specification
  • Lay out and mark dimensions and reference lines on material, using scribes, dividers, squares, tape / ruler, and protractors, applying knowledge of shop mathematics and layout techniques to develop and trace patterns of product or parts
  • Set up and operate fabricating machines such as shears, brakes, presses, forming rollers, ironworkers, and routers
  • Shape metal material over anvil, blocks, or other forms, using heat, and hand tools
  • Cut, grind, file, deburr, smooth, and polish surfaces using hand, and power tools
  • Weld, solder, rivet, screw, bolt, caulk and bond component parts to assemble products using hand, and power tools, and equipment
  • Install assemblies in supportive framework according to blueprints, and sketches, using hand tools, power tools, and lifting, and handling devices
  • Responsible for keeping work area, machines, and equipment safe, clean, and in good working order
  • Assure that any other safety issues are complied with that relate to the specific job being accomplished (Example: special staging, face shields for grinding, protective clothing for hot work-related jobs, breathing apparatus with correct cartridges, etc.)
  • Assure that Earl’s Torch Safety Procedures, including testing, are utilized for all torch work
  • Assure that fire watches are assigned and maintained in the proper position.
  • Assure that you are trained or qualified for the work you are assigned to do (Example: JLG, forklift, welding, brazing, special electrical / mechanical repairs and etc.)
  • Assure that you and personnel working under your direction are working as safely and as productively as possible maintaining quality control at all times
  • Assure that job site is left in a safe and clean condition prior to departure
  • Assure that a 30-minute cool down period has been accomplished in hot work areas
